DRUMMING INFO: I draws from a wide range of musical influences. Fluent in Blues, Rock, Jazz, Funk, Soul, Country, Texas Swing, Zydeco, New Orleans Second Line, and Latin music. After a lot of hard work I received a Music Scholarship to Austin Peay State University with a percussion major / piano minor. I have performed in Asia, the Caribbean, Europe and all around the US. In 2006 I was awarded the “Music City Blues Drummer of the Year” by the Nashville Blues Society. I have a drumming CD “Beats Grooves & Drum Solos” on the ACM label (perform grooves in various genres and short drum solos).
